How often should you wash powder puff?

If you ask us, you’re looking at a puffy bath time at least every one to two weeks to keep the bacteria at bay. How to: Cleaning your puffs is almost similar to cleaning your sponges—the key is lots of soapy, lukewarm water, and a hefty amount of squeezing.

How many times can you use a powder puff?

POWDER PUFFS: According to Lim: “For loose powder puff, you may wash it once or twice. After that, it’s best to replace with a new one. Pressed powder puffs don’t hold their shape after washing and can also harbour germs in a closed compact. Get a new one instead.”

How do you use powder puff setting powder?

-Remove excess powder by tapping the puff on top of your hand. –Gently press puff on the skin, using a rolling motion to “work” the powder into the skin to set makeup. -The key is to not see powder when you put it on; the result is soft-focus skin with a matte finish. -Use it for application to all areas of the face.

Is it better to apply powder foundation with a brush or sponge?

A brush or sponge can be used to apply powder foundation, though brushes are generally preferred. Brushes will give a more natural and buildable coverage, whereas sponges can tend to deposit too much product onto the skin and give a cakey finish.

Should I wet my sponge before applying foundation?

The first step is wetting your sponge. You should never use a makeup sponge dry to apply foundation, especially if it’s a beautyblender, says Bartlett. She recommends squishing it under water about eight times until it’s fully saturated. Then, wring out the excess water.
